Thu, 08 Mar 2012 | COMMERCIAL PROPERTY
Business agent Christie + Co. has announced that it has been instructed to sell the Shop Smart convenience store and the adjacent takeaway, Munchies 2 Go, in Glasgow.
The Renfrew-based property is around six miles from Glasgow’s city centre. Renfrew is a popular area to live for commuters and also has excellent transport links, with good access to the M8 motorway.
The units are close to Renfrew’s main street and benefit from passing trade as well as business from the residential suburbs, according to Christie + Co.
The convenience store has modern fixtures and fittings and stocks a wide range of goods as well as having an alcohol licence. The takeaway was added to the business in summer last year and caters to the breakfast and lunchtime takeaway food market.
Offers over £65,000 are being sought for the leasehold interest with an annual rent of £15,600. There is around 19 years left on the lease.
Paul Graham, retail negotiator at Christie + Co's Glasgow Office, who is handling the sale, commented, “This business has been run by the current owner for the last twelve-and-a-half years, and has been placed on the market because the owner is retiring from the trade."
